Luxchem - Net profit more than Doubled. Uptrend Stock


Luxchem Corp Bhd's net profit more than doubled to RM14.82 million or 5.64 sen per share in the fourth quarter ended Dec 31, 2015 (4QFY15), compared to RM6.29 million or 2.42 sen per share a year earlier.
The better earnings were underpinned by higher contribution from the trading and manufacturing segment and the reversal of RM4.29 million in employee benefit expense during the quarter, it told Bursa Malaysia today.
Revenue for the quarter was also higher at RM183.27 million, up 24.57% from RM147.12 million in 4QFY14. Luxchem is proposing a single tier final dividend of 4.5 sen per share for the financial year ended Dec 31, 2015, subject to the shareholders' approval at the forthcoming annual general meeting.
Construction piling specialist Pintaras Jaya Bhd's net profit slumped 83.3% to RM2.53 million in the second quarter ended Dec 31, 2015 (2QFY16), from RM15.17 million a year ago due to the low rate of project replenishment and cost overruns in the construction business.
The company told Bursa Malaysia today its revenue slid 57.9% to RM31.22 million from RM74.11 million in 2QFY15.
"The decline was attributable mainly to the lower contribution from both the construction and manufacturing divisions coupled with a lower investment income," it said.

How to Short KLCI using CFD

Will KLCI Drop like the rest of the world? Do you know China drop 12% in the first week of 2016? KLCI drop from 1866 to 1500 in 2015(that was near 20%). Many people ask how can they short KLCI index, what I am using is CFD, reason being it is a leverage product, I dont have to buy 1:1 like shares.

How much you need for 1 contract of KLCI CFD?
Each contract only requires 5% margin (e.g like a deposit or down payment), which means if KLCI is now 1650, one contract will worth RM16500, but you only need 5% of that to own 1 contract which is RM825

How it works is each point up or down is reflected in the Name of the CFD contract
FBM KLCI MYR10 - this means each point is 10 Ringgit. If you long 1 contract and it goes up 20point, you make RM200, if down 20point you lose RM200
commission for KLCI cfd is RM5 per side/lot. Interest is 4% per year(usually you dont hold very long for index, so you can calculate this by per day basis)

More other CFD product details can refer to the link below.
Phillip CFD Products List (S'pore, M'sia, US, HK, China, World Indices, ETFs)

Expiry date?
For CFD all profit and losses are instant, if you make a profit, the money will credit into you available cash, if you lose it will deduct from your available cash. You can open a contract as long as possible and provided you have enough Available cash in your CFD account. Unlike futures, this does not have an expiry date that you have to close off the position.

Margin Call
In the Event your Available cash falls below ZERO, that will be the margin call, you can either choose to top up the account or you can close the position.

Uptrend Stock in KLSE


Business Summary

Focus Lumber Berhad is a Malaysia-based company engaged in the manufacturing and sale of plywood, veneer and laminated veneer lumber (LVL). The Company operates through two segments: the manufacturing segment, which is involved in manufacturing and sale of plywood, veneer and laminated veneer lumber, and the electricity segment, which is engaged in generation and sale of electricity. Plywood is used in industries, such as the Recreational Vehicle (RV), home decorating, construction and furniture industries. Veneer is a thin sheet of wood which forms the building blocks of plywood. It varies in thickness from 0.60 millimeters to 3.6millimeters. Laminated veneer lumber is produced using recycled wood chips and veneer slips, which is used in the construction industry for structural integrity, production of high-value furniture, housing materials and value-added products. The Company’s subsidiary is Untung Ria Sdn. Bhd. 

Business Summary

Inari Amertron Berhad, formerly Inari Amertron Berhad, is Malaysia-based investment holding company engaged in the provision of management services. The Company operates in 3 segments: Electronic Manufacturing services, Original design manufacturer of electronic test and measurement equipment and Investment holding. The Company is engaged in the manufacturing of electronic products segment. Its services include wafer sort, assembly, RF testing and other services. Wafer sort includes raw die bank, wafer mounting, sawing, wafer thinning and die sort tape and reel. RF testing includes support up to 50 gigahertz testing frequency, MXA+MXG to support high speed GAIN, ENA to support S-parameter measurement and turret testing and tape and real. The Company has production facilities in Malaysia, Philippines and China. The Company's subsidiaries include Inari Technology Sdn. Berhad, Inari South Keytech Sdn. Berhad, Simfoni Bistari Sdn. Berhad, Ceedtec Sdn. Berhad. 

Business Summary

Karex Berhad (Karex) is a Malaysia-based investment holding company. The Company is engaged in manufacturing and sale of condoms, latex probe covers, sterile catheters and other rubber products. It also manufactures lubricating jelly and other medical devices. The Company operates through three segments: Condoms, Catheters, and Probe covers, lubricating jelly and others. Karex manufactures condoms under its own brands Carex and INNO, in which it exports to the Middle Eastern countries. It manufactures condoms in various shapes, sizes, textures/surfaces, colors, flavors and fragrances. Karex has approximately three manufacturing facilities across Pontian, Johor, Port Klang Selangor and Hat Yai, Thailand with a capacity to produce approximately four billion pieces of condom per annum. Its customers include commercial global brand owners, government and non-government agencies. Its subsidiaries include Karex Industries Sdn. Bhd., Hevea Medical Sdn. Bhd. and Innolatex Sdn. Bhd.
